Matter stalled, with the Matter advanced through a constitutional avenue. In 1533, with the support of both Parliament and the Clergy, the marriage of King Henry VIII and Anne Boleyn occurred, followed by the Act of Supremacy in 1534. The authority of Rome was renounced, with Henry appointed the Head of the English Church and subsequently had greater power than any previous King .
